Struggling Young Makes Key Shots in Wizards' Win
LAS VEGAS, July 19 -- Guard Nick Young showed that he has potential to be a major scorer in the NBA when he came off the bench and scored 27 points during a Washington Wizards loss to the Lakers in his home town of Los Angeles back on March 30.
Young, who averaged 7.5 points in 15.5 minutes as a rookie, is hoping to provide more performances like that memorable one this season. With that in mind, Young came to the NBA summer league looking to show that he's ready to build on last season's experiences.

With an Assist From Mom, McGee Finds Way to NBA
For nearly his entire life, JaVale McGee has been referred to as 'Pamela McGee's son.'
After the Wizards selected the 7-foot, 237-pound McGee with the 18th pick in the NBA draft on Thursday night, a proud Pamela McGee -- an all-American basketball player at USC in the early 1980s who played two seasons in the WNBA -- was more than happy to reverse roles.
'I told him that now I'm JaVale McGee's mother and that's fine with me,' Pamela McGee said after her son was introduced during a news conference at Verizon Center yesterday afternoon. 'I always used to tell him: 'I gave you life so you're known as Pam McGee's son.' And he would say: 'No mom, you don't play anymore.' But now, I'll be JaVale McGee's mom. It's politically correct to say that now.'

“Get our bench some minutes and then hope that nobody gets hurt.”
With nothing at stake for Washington or Orlando, veteran guard Antonio Daniels believes the Wizards should have only one goal in tonight's regular season finale: Get out of the game healthy.
'The biggest thing at this time of the year when you know what's going on is to stay healthy and not have any injuries in that last game of the season,' said Daniels, who has been playing with a torn ligament in his left wrist that will require surgery after the season. 'That's the biggest concern. You want to go into Cleveland as healthy as possible with all of the firepower we have. We want to get Gilbert [Arenas] healthy, get Caron [Butler] healthy and then we'll have those couple of days before Game 1 to get our chemistry together and get ready to go.
